"Kimmy Goes to the Doctor!" is the fourth episode in the first season of Netflix's original series, Unbreakable Kimmy Schmidt. It was written by Jack Burditt and Tina Fey and directed by Tristam Shapeero.
Synopsis[]
Kimmy has an eye-opening experience when Jaqueline introduces her to her plastic surgeon. Titus auditions for a Spider-Man musical.
